You don’t necessarily need to have some type of prestigious formal training in order to teach yourself to play guitar. There have been many successful musicians who started playing as self-taught learners. You too can teach yourself too. Here are three ways you can start. 1.) First things first, you need a guitar to play! Perhaps, you’ve already bought one, but you might want to consider borrowing a friend’s when you first start teaching yourself. When you first start, you’ll need to decide if you want to learn acoustic guitar or electric guitar. One is not necessarily better to learn than the other. It depends on your goals and what type of music you want to play. 2.) Start searching online. The internet has a wealth of information to teach yourself to play guitar. When you first start, you will need to learn some of your basic chords. Your very common chords will be: A, E, D, C, G, Em, Am, Dm.
